got bored and decided to mess around with some vht niteshades, the headlights didnt' look right, so i decided to try taping off and spraying them this way:

Note: For some reason vht didn't want to adhere to the headlights, cleaned thoroughly and it worked. I still need to touch up and clear the whole thing, then wet sand. Also need to take sharp knife gently around the tape-off areas because i didn't give them time to dry i had an emergency mid-project.

However, i've taped of spots of tail lights (reverse lights) to be sprayed and had great success before, so i probably wouldn't have to do any of this again if i had just a) waited till it was warmer and b) allowed more time to dry.

Not sure if this is "original" i haven't seen anybody else try this, and personally i like it better than the aftermarket housings and it's much cheaper. (14 dollars a can for this stuff on ebay). I call my cheapo creation "rover headlights" because they look like wannabe rover lights.
